摘 要 目的:采用Meta分析方法评价雷替曲塞治疗中晚期原发性肝癌的疗效及安全性。方法: 计算机检索 PubMed、Web of Science、Embase、The Cochrane Library、SinoMed、CNKI、VIP、WanFang Data数据库,收集雷替曲塞治疗中晚期原发性肝癌的随机对照试验(RCTs),检索年限均为建库开始至2017年12月,由两位研究者独立进行文献筛选、资料提取和方法学质量评价后,采用RevMan 5.2软件进行 Meta 分析。结果: 共纳入8项研究,合计821例患者。Meta分析显示,在疗效方面,试验组(雷替曲塞治疗)患者总有效率[OR=2.09,95%CI(1.48,2.93),P<0.001]、疾病控制率[OR=2.63,95%CI(1.90,3.64),P<0.001]、1年生存率[OR=2.12,95%CI(1.34,3.34),P=0.001]、2年生存率[OR=2.93,95%CI(1.76,4.88),P<0.001]、甲胎蛋白下降率[OR=3.36,95%CI(1.98,5.69),P<0.001]、转氨酶下降率[OR=2.99,95%CI(1.65,5.43),P<0.001]、胆红素下降率[OR=3.07,95%CI(1.70,5.55),P<0.001],均显著高于对照组(非雷替曲塞治疗),且差异有统计学意义。在安全性方面,试验组不良反应的发生率均低于对照组,其中胃肠道反应的有统计学意义[OR=0.62,95%CI(0.41,0.93),P<0.05]。结论: 当前证据显示,雷替曲塞能提高中晚期原发性肝癌的临床疗效,同时减少不良反应发生,该结论有待高质量、大样本的RCTs进一步验证。  相似文献

摘 要 目的:综合评价肿瘤患者使用酪氨酸激酶抑制药(TKI)导致肝毒性的风险,为临床治疗提供循证参考。方法:计算机检索PubMed、EMBase、SinoMed、Cochrane图书馆、中国期刊全文数据库、万方数据库,搜集TKI对比安慰剂治疗肿瘤的随机对照试验(RCT),筛选文献,提取资料,采用RevMan 5.2统计软件进行Meta分析。结果:共纳入13篇文献,合计3 931例受试者。Meta分析结果显示,TKI组丙氨酸氨基转氨酶(ALT)升高≥3级的发生率 (OR=3.77,95%CI:2.08~6.83,P<0.000 1),天门冬氨酸氨基转氨酶(AST)升高≥3级的发生率(OR=3.85,95%CI:2.55~5.82,P<0.000 1)显著高于对照组,而血清总胆红素(TB)升高≥3级的发生率(OR=1.89,95%CI:0.90~3.96,P=0.09)与对照组相比差异无统计学意义。结论:现有的证据表明肿瘤患者使用TKI发生肝毒性的风险显著升高,提示在临床用药过程中,需对患者肝功能进行定期检查及监护。  相似文献

摘 要 目的:利用Meta分析方法对法舒地尔注射液防治动脉瘤术后脑血管痉挛的疗效和安全性评价分析。方法: 计算机检索PubMed、EMbase、The Cochrane Library、维普、万方、CNKI等数据库公开发表的随机对照研究文献。筛选符合纳入标准的文献进行研究,采用RevMan 5.0软件统计Meta分析。结果: 初检出418篇文献,最终纳入11篇,共786例患者。在治疗动脉瘤性蛛网膜下腔出血的脑血管痉挛的有效率方面,尼莫地平组与法舒地尔组的差异无统计学意义(OR=1.56,95%CI:0.95~2.58,P>0.05),法舒地尔组脑血管痉挛的发生率低于尼莫地平组(OR=0.43,95%CI:0.23~0.81,P=0.008),法舒地尔组不良反应的发生率高于尼莫地平组(OR=0.43,95%CI:0.25~0.75,P=0.003)。结论:与尼莫地平注射液预防动脉瘤性蛛网膜下腔出血的脑血管痉挛的发生率相比,法舒地尔可能有更好的效果,但对于已发生的脑血管痉挛的治疗有效率无明显差异,相反法舒地尔发生不良反应相对较多。  相似文献

摘 要 目的:采用Meta分析方法评价非洛地平对比硝苯地平治疗中国人原发性高血压的疗效和安全性。方法:计算机检索the Cochrane Library(2016年第11期)、PubMed、MEDLINE、Embase、CNKI、WanFang Data、VIP、SinoMed,检索时限均为建库至2016年11月15日,全面收集非洛地平对比硝苯地平治疗中国人原发性高血压的随机对照试验(RCTs)。采用Cochrane系统评价手册进行严格质量评价,经RevMan 5.3统计软件对符合标准的RCTs进行Meta分析,并用GRADE profiler 3.6软件进行证据质量评价。结果:共纳入14个RCTs,包括1 909例患者。Meta分析结果显示,与硝苯地平相比,非洛地平能提高原发性高血压患者的总有效率(OR=3.58,95%CI:2.08~6.18,P<0.05)和显效率(OR=2.24,95%CI:1.52~3.31,P<0.05),增加收缩压降低值(ΔSBP,MD=5.83,95%CI:0.70~10.97,P<0.05)和舒张压降低值(ΔDBP,MD=3.63,95%CI:-0.02~7.29,P=0.05),降低药品不良反应发生率(RR=0.41,95%CI:0.31~0.55,P<0.05)。证据等级显示,总有效率、ΔSBP和ΔDBP为极低级,显效率和ADR发生率为低级,推荐强度均为弱推荐。结论:基于现有临床证据,与硝苯地平比较,非洛地平疗效和安全性均更好,值得临床推广。由于纳入研究的质量不高,该结论有待高质量的RCTs进一步验证。  相似文献

摘 要 目的:采用Meta分析方法评价耐碳青霉烯类铜绿假单胞菌(CRPA)感染的危险因素。方法:计算机检索PubMed、The Cochrane Library、Embase、CNKI、WanFang Data和VIP数据库中有关CRPA感染危险因素的研究,检索时限均从建库至2018年1月。采用RevMan 5.3软件对纳入的研究进行Meta分析。根据不同区域研究人群进行亚组分析,发现纳入研究的异质性来源。结果:22篇研究(6 097例患者)符合纳入标准。Meta分析结果显示,病例组(发生CRPA感染)的机械通气[OR=1.64,95%CI(1.42,1.89)],使用碳青霉烯类[OR=7.15,95%CI(3.52,14.52)]、亚胺培南[OR=7.89,95%CI(3.90,15.93)]、氟喹诺酮类[OR=2.88,95%CI(2.12,3.90)]、哌拉西林/他唑巴坦[OR=4.46,95%CI(2.33,8.53)]、万古霉素[OR=5.39,95%CI(3.94,7.37)],入住ICU [OR=2.88,95%CI(2.12,3.90)],住院天数[WMD=6.53,95%CI(1.33,11.73)]等8个危险因素的分布与未发生CRPA感染的对照组比较,差异均有统计学意义(P<0.05)。亚组分析不同区域研究人群使用碳青霉烯类、亚胺培南的结果,其中亚洲人群存在高度异质性分别为(P≤0.1,I2=87%)、(P≤0.1,I2=85%)。结论:针对存在高危因素的患者,应结合危险因素及早采取预防措施,降低CRPA感染的发生率。  相似文献

摘 要 目的:系统评价复方苦参注射液联合FOLFOX化疗方案治疗大肠癌临床疗效及安全性。方法:EMBASE、PubMed、Cochrane Library、CancerLit、中国期刊全文数据库(CNKI)、中文科技期刊全文数据库(VIP)、中国生物医学文献数据库(SinoMed)、万方数据库等数据库1979~2016年文献,全面搜集复方苦参注射液联合FOLFOX化疗方案治疗大肠癌的随机对照试验,对纳入文献进行质量评价,提取资料并通过RevMan 5.3软件进行数据分析。结果:共纳入26 篇文献,累计2 269例受试者。Meta 分析结果显示:在FOLFOX化疗方案基础上联用复方苦参注射液治疗大肠癌的临床疗效优于对照组仅用FOLFOX化疗方案 (RR=1.35, 95%CI:1.23~1.40, P<0.000 01), 生存质量明显改善(RR=1.58, 95%CI: 1.37~1.83, P<0.000 01)。此外,复方苦参注射液还可降低化疗引起的不良反应的发生率,如白细胞减少(RR=0.62,95%CI:0.42~0.93,P=0.02),恶心呕吐(RR=0.63, 95%CI: 0.50~0.80, P=0.000 2)。 结论:〖JP〗复方苦参注射液联合FOLFOX化疗方案在治疗大肠癌方面具有较好的疗效。  相似文献

摘 要 目的:系统评价泮托拉唑的不良反应,分析其临床应用的安全性,为泮托拉唑的合理使用提供参考。 方法: 计算机检索PubMed、Embase、The Cochrane Library、Clinicaltrials.gov、CNKI、WanFang Data和SinoMed数据库,搜集单用泮托拉唑或在对照组(使用其他药物)基础上加用泮托拉唑的随机对照试验(RCTs),检索时限均为建库至2018年5月31日。两名研究者独立筛选文献、提取资料并进行偏倚风险评价后,采用RevMan 5.3软件进行Meta分析。 结果: 共纳入26个RCTs,合计6 396例患者。Meta分析结果显示,两组患者总体不良反应发生率的差异无统计学意义[OR=0.91,95%CI(0.77,1.08),P>0.05]。亚组分析显示,适应证为食管炎时,泮托拉唑组总的不良反应发生率高于对照组,差异无统计学意义[OR=1.19,95%CI(0.80,1.76),P>0.05];适应证为消化性溃疡[OR=0.56,95%CI(0.33,0.94),P=0.03]、口服用药[OR=0.68,95%CI(0.48,0.96),P=0.03]、单独用药[OR=0.60,95%CI(0.37,0.98),P=0.04]时,泮托拉唑组胃肠系统损害发生率低于对照组,两组的差异有统计学意义;疗程>8周时,泮托拉唑组总的不良反应发生率高于对照组,但差异无统计学意义[OR=1.07,95%CI(0.79,1.45),P>0.05];与奥美拉唑比较,泮托拉唑胃肠系统损害发生率更低,差异有统计学意义[OR=0.60,95%CI(0.44,0.83),P=0.002]。结论: 泮托拉唑不良反应主要累及中枢及外周神经系统、胃肠系统、皮肤及其附件。治疗食管炎时、疗程>8周时,应特别注意其不良反应的发生。在治疗消化性溃疡、口服用药、单独用药或与其他药物比较时,泮托拉唑胃肠系统损害发生率更低,适合胃肠功能障碍的患者。  相似文献

摘 要 目的:采用Meta分析方法评价七叶皂苷联合依达拉奉治疗脑出血的有效性与安全性。方法:计算机检索PubMed、Embase、the Cochrane Library、CNKI、WangFang Data、SinoMed和VIP,检索时限均从各数据库建库至2016年4月,纳入七叶皂苷联合依达拉奉治疗脑出血的随机对照试验(RCT),进行数据提取和质量评价后,使用RevMan 5.3软件进行Meta分析。结果以均数差(MD)、相对危险度(RR)、比值比(OR)、95%置信区间(CI)等指标进行分析。结果:共纳入13个RCT,共计1 046例患者。Meta分析结果显示:七叶皂苷联合依达拉奉能够提高临床疗效(RR=1.38, 95%CI:1.27~1.49, P<0.000 01),减少NIHSS评分(MD=-4.98, 95%CI:-6.85~-3.21, P<0.000 01)和NDS评分(MD=-7.98, 95%CI:-12.03~-3.93, P=0.000 1),有效地减少脑水肿体积(MD=-2.61, 95%CI:-3.99~-1.22, P=0.000 2)与脑出血体积(MD=-6.03, 95%CI:-11.35~-0.70, P<0.03);安全性方面因仅1项研究报道了不良反应发生情况,故无法评价。结论:七叶皂苷联合依达拉奉能够有效地提高临床疗效,减少NIHSS评分或NDS评分缩小患者的脑水肿、脑血肿的体积,但是其安全性仍需要进一步的探讨。  相似文献

摘 要 目的:采用Meta分析的方法评价中药复方治疗青春期多囊卵巢综合征(PCOS)有效性。方法:计算机检索SinoMed、CNKI、VIP、WanFang Data、PubMed、Cochrane Library、Embase数据库中有关中药复方治疗青春期PCOS的随机对照试验(RCTs),检索时限均为1989年1月~2018年4月。由两名研究人员独立筛选文献、提取资料并评价纳入研究的偏倚风险后,采用RevMan 5.3软件进行Meta分析。结果:共纳入10个RCTs,共698例患者,其中中药复方组350例,单纯西药组348例。Meta分析结果显示,中药复方治疗青春期PCOS临床总有效率优于单纯西药组[OR=4.56,95%CI(2.68,7.76),P<0.000 01],中药复方在提高青春期PCOS患者月经周期恢复率[OR=4.73,95%CI(2.31,9.69),P<0.000 1]、排卵率[OR=4.14,95%CI(1.77,9.67),P=0.001]优于西药组。并可有效改善患者卵巢平均体积[MD=-2.55,95%CI(-3.02,-2.08),P<0.000 01]以及降低BMI指数[MD=-2.51,95%CI(-3.13,-1.90),P<0.000 01]。中药复方组在治疗青春期PCOS患者时药品不良反应发生率低于单纯西药组[OR=0.03, 95%CI(0.01,0.10),P<0.000 01],但两者在改善青春期PCOS患者多毛症状无明显差异[MD=-3.63,95%CI(-7.79,0.53),P=0.09]。结论:中药复方治疗青春期PCOS患者临床有效率优于单纯西药治疗,可有效恢复其月经周期、促进排卵、缩小卵巢平均体积,以及降低其BMI指数,且中药复方有着更好的药物安全性。但在改善其多毛症状时,两者无明显差异。受纳入研究数量和质量所限,本研究结论尚待更多高质量研究予以验证。  相似文献

摘 要 目的:系统评价紫杉醇联合奈达铂对卵巢癌患者进行治疗的安全性和有效性。方法:计算机检索PubMed、Cochrane Library、Embase、CNKI、WanFang Data、SinoMed数据库,搜集有关紫杉醇联合奈达铂治疗卵巢癌的随机对照试验(RCTs)。检索时限均为建库至2018年4月,由两名研究者独立筛选文献、提取资料并评价纳入研究的偏倚风险后,采用 RevMan 5.3软件进行分析。 结果:共纳入12 项研究,包括1 219 例患者。Meta分析结果显示,紫杉醇联合奈达铂治疗卵巢癌的总有效率与其他化疗方案相比,差异无统计学意义[OR=1.14,95%CI (0.88,1.48),P=0.16],但紫杉醇联合奈达铂可提高患者1年生存率[OR=3.37,95%CI(1.47,7.71),P=0.004]和2年生存率[OR=2.24,95%CI(1.27,3.97),P=0.006],并且该方案显著减少了不良反应的发生率:血小板降低[OR=0.49,95%CI(0.36,0.66),P=0.000 01]、恶心呕吐[OR=0.65,95%CI(0.47,0.89),P=0.007]、外周神经毒性[OR=0.43,95%CI(0.28,0.67),P=0.000 2]及肝功能损伤[OR=0.39,95%CI(0.20,0.77),P=0.006]等不良反应的发生率。 结论:紫杉醇联合奈达铂治疗卵巢癌可延长患者1年及2年生存率且不良反应较轻,受研究数量和质量的限制,结论还需更多高质量的RCTs进行验证。  相似文献

Clinical and in vitro investigations were carried out to test the efficacy of gut lavage, hemodialysis, and hemoperfusion in the treatment of poisoning with paraquat or diquat. In a patient suffering from diquat intoxication 130 times more diquat was removed by gut lavage 30 h after ingestion than was removed by complete aspiration of the gastric contents.Determination of in vitro clearances for paraquat and diquat by hemodialysis showed that, at serum concentrations of 1–2 ppm, such as are frequently encountered in poisoning in man, toxicologically relevant quantities of herbicide cannot be removed from the body. At a concentration of 20 ppm, on the other hand, hemodialysis proved to be effective, the clearance being 70 ml/min at a blood flow rate of 100 ml/min. The efficacy of hemoperfusion with coated activated charcoal was on the whole better. Especially at concentrations around 1–2 ppm, the clearance values for hemoperfusion were some 5–7 times higher than those for hemodialysis.In a patient suffering from paraquat poisoning, both hemodialysis as well as hemoperfusion were carried out. The in vitro results could be confirmed: At serum concentrations of paraquat less than 1 ppm no clearance could be obtained by hemodialysis while by hemoperfusion with activated charcoal quite high clearance values were measured and the serum level dropped down to zero.

This study describes a new approach for organophosphorous (OP) antidotal treatment by encapsulating an OP hydrolyzing enzyme, OPA anhydrolase (OPAA), within sterically stabilized liposomes. The recombinant OPAA enzyme was derived from Alteromonas strain JD6. It has broad substrate specificity to a wide range of OP compounds: DFP and the nerve agents, soman and sarin. Liposomes encapsulating OPAA (SL)* were made by mechanical dispersion method. Hydrolysis of DFP by (SL)* was measured by following an increase of fluoride ion concentration using a fluoride ion selective electrode. OPAA entrapped in the carrier liposomes rapidly hydrolyze DFP, with the rate of DFP hydrolysis directly proportional to the amount of (SL)* added to the solution. Liposomal carriers containing no enzyme did not hydrolyze DFP. The reaction was linear and the rate of hydrolysis was first order in the substrate. This enzyme carrier system serves as a biodegradable protective environment for the recombinant OP-metabolizing enzyme, OPAA, resulting in prolongation of enzymatic concentration in the body. These studies suggest that the protection of OP intoxication can be strikingly enhanced by adding OPAA encapsulated within (SL)* to pralidoxime and atropine.  相似文献

The uptake of metals from food and water sources by insects is thought to be additive. For a given metal, the proportions taken up from water and food will depend both on the bioavailable concentration of the metal associated with each source and the mechanism and rate by which the metal enters the insect. Attempts to correlate insect trace metal concentrations with the trophic level of insects should be made with a knowledge of the feeding relationships of the individual taxa concerned. Pathways for the uptake of essential metals, such as copper and zinc, exist at the cellular level, and other nonessential metals, such as cadmium, also appear to enter via these routes. Within cells, trace metals can be bound to proteins or stored in granules. The internal distribution of metals among body tissues is very heterogeneous, and distribution patterns tend to be both metal and taxon specific. Trace metals associated with insects can be both bound on the surface of their chitinous exoskeleton and incorporated into body tissues. The quantities of trace meals accumulated by an individual reflect the net balance between the rate of metal influx from both dissolved and particulate sources and the rate of metal efflux from the organism. The toxicity of metals has been demonstrated at all levels of biological organization: cell, tissue, individual, population, and community. Much of the literature pertaining to the toxic effects of metals on aquatic insects is based on laboratory observations and, as such, it is difficult to extrapolate the data to insects in nature. The few experimental studies in nature suggest that trace metal contaminants can affect both the distribution and the abundance of aquatic insects. Insects have a largely unexploited potential as biomonitors of metal contamination in nature. A better understanding of the physico-chemical and biological mechanisms mediating trace metal bioavailability and exchange will facilitate the development of general predictive models relating trace metal concentrations in insects to those in their environment. Such models will facilitate the use of insects as contaminant biomonitors.  相似文献

In order to find out the values of the steroid resources for the future use. the compositions and contents of steroidal sapogenins from 13 domestic plants have been investigated. As a result,Dioscorea nipponica, D. quinqueloba andSmilax china were found to have large amount of diosgenin. And pennogenin inTrillium kamtschaticum andParis verticillata, yuccagenin inAllium fistulosum, hecogenin inAgave americana and neochlorogenin inSolanum nigum were appeared to be major steroidal sapogenins.  相似文献

Advances in the molecular biological knowledge of neuronal nicotinic acetylcholine receptors (nAChRs) have led to a growing interest by the pharmaceutical industry in the development of novel compounds that selectively modulate nAChR function. The ability of (-)-nicotine, an activator of nAChRs, to enhance attentional aspects of cognition in animals and humans, to exert neuroprotective and anxiolytic-like effects, and presumably to mediate the negative correlation between smoking and Alzheimer's (and Parkinson's) Disease, has focused interest on the potential therapeutic utility of modulators of nAChR function for treatment of some of the deficits associated with these progressive, neurodegenerative conditions. Numerous compounds are known which activate nAChRs and which might serve as lead compounds toward the development of such agents. The pharmacologic diversity of neuronal nAChR subtypes suggests the possibility of developing selective compounds which would have more favourable side-effect profiles than existing agents. This broader class of agents, collectively called cholinergic channel modulators (ChCMs), is anticipated to encompass compounds which would have more favourable side-effect profiles than existing agents, which generally exhibit low selectivity. This selectivity may be achieved by preferentially activating some subtypes of nAChRs (i.e., Cholinergic Channel Activators, ChCAs) or inhibiting the function of other subtypes (Cholinergic Channel Inhibitors, ChCIs). An overview of the biology of nAChRs and the rationale for the use of ChCMs for the treatment of dementia related to neurodegenerative diseases are presented, followed by a discussion of lead compounds and compounds under consideration for clinical evaluation.  相似文献
